Quote:

Originally Posted by Kyuzo
No, I've been running websites for the past 8 years. When the server is too busy, on a forum script like this one, it doesn't have anything to do with the bandwidth... otherwise the forum itself would not load and you'd get a cogent message saying Bandwidth Limit Exceeded.

However, seeing this message it means that there are too many connections to mySQL happening at once, and the script cannot handle the parse load.

.... MEANING... lol.......... when you see that message.... usually too many people are trying to post a topic all at once. It doesn't necessarily mean too many people on the forum. But usually too many people calling the script to parse an action, it will say it is too busy.

The forum will be able to handle many connections to the forum, but when many people ALL AT ONCE try to post a topic or parse the php script, it becomes busy. I hope that's easy to understand.


Maybe the connections aren't terminating correctly and just sit there until they time out? Then once too many connections are opened up, you start getting the server is busy? Just a thought. Not even sure how this site is set up or how php works.
